New, city address a sign of big things to come for Equilibrium

Announcement posted by Wise PR Consulting 12 Apr 2017

In a strategic move, and one crucial to the agency’s growth plans, digital agency Equilibrium has relocated to a new, King Street address. 

Equilibrium’s Managing Director Warren Gibbs said, “Our attitude to date has been that we lead with our client work, this is what is most important, and the rest can wait.

“But there comes a time when four walls and an address stop being compatible with your culture, the reputation you’ve built and future goals.

“It was time for us to design change around our culture, so it was important to find the “right” space to support our people, our processes and our business strategy in a way that is conducive to growth.”

For the first time in 21 years, Equilibrium has a new home at Level 1, 77 King Street, between Murray and Wellington Streets in the heart of Perth’s CBD; a location that positions the agency closer to their growing number of blue-chip clients.

“Of course, central to the appeal of the King Street premises is accessibility to our clients. It feels good to be in the thick of the action in Perth.”

The team contracted Perth, design specialists IA Design to direct customised upgrades to the generous, 360sqm space which features an impressive, north-facing boardroom with vantage to neighbouring hospitality venues; an open plan main floor area, partitioned offices and a heritage vault room converted to new, end of trip facilities.

“We definitely draw inspiration from an approach favoured by many of the world’s most innovative companies that sees shared space and accidental interaction as key to quality collaboration and creativity.

“Within this space, we are able to create a central hub for our designers, developers and UX experts to work collaboratively, and balance this with break-away common, and generic “thinking” areas within the open-plan.

"With our team, we see a tendency for a blurring of the boundaries between work and personal life. We don’t want our people chained to the desk, we want them to take full advantage of the office space, and the amenity on offer right outside the front door.”

The “perfect fusion of heritage and hi-tech”, Mr Gibbs adds the Equilibrium team settled in quick.

“The mood, energy and enthusiasm are through the roof, everyone is pumped to be here.

With the space still undergoing some final customisation, Equilibrium will be ready to officially launch their arrival with an end of financial year party. Between now and then, they will be kept busy with business as usual.

Equilibrium

In its 22nd year, Equilibrium is one of Perth’s longest running and most awarded digital agencies. Now based in King Street, Perth, the agency continues to be sought out by blue-chip clients, due largely to their reputation for delivering on complex digital business solutions.

The agency’s significant investment in this ‘strategy first, execution second’ approach has gone a long way to informing their success across a generous portfolio of large-scale digital projects.

In 2016, Equilibrium’s most notable projects made use of the spectrum of services, from digital strategy to complex web development solutions, mobile and app development and digital campaigns.

Their client list includes, but is not limited to: Sodexo, Western Power, INPEX Australia, Department of Transport, VenuesWest, State Heritage Office, University of Western Australia, Summit Homes Group, Fortescue Metals Group, Steel Blue, Department of Health, Department of Education and Horizon Power.

More recently the agency has, redeveloped websites for the Fremantle Prison, VenuesWest, The Department of Transport, and The Department of Child Protection and Family Services.
